The girl child today faces inequality and gender based discriminations even before birth. The nation cannot move forward unless women are given opportunity to realize their full potential and contribute to nation building.

Given this context, please share your thoughts, ideas, suggestions and feedback on how we can change the discriminatory social construct in order to celebrate the girl child. What should be our communication strategy for improving the situation and reach out to people?
